In diesem Lernprogramm werden Sie Schritt für Schritt durch das Einrichten von Daten für die Erstellung einer Big-Data-Dateifreigabe geführt. Bei einer Big-Data-Dateifreigabe handelt es sich um ein Element, das in Ihrem Portal erstellt wird und Feature-Daten (Tabellen, Punkte, Polylinien und Polygone) an einem Speicherort referenziert, der für Ihren GeoAnalytics Server verfügbar ist. Das Big-Data-Dateifreigabeelement in Ihrem Portal ermöglicht Ihnen die Verwaltung registrierter Daten und die Suche nach diesen, sodass Sie GeoAnalytics Tools für Ihre Datasets ausführen können. Nachdem Sie eine Big-Data-Dateifreigabe erstellt haben, verwenden Sie die Daten mithilfe des Werkzeugs Punkte zusammenfassen. In diesem Lernprogramm laden Sie ein Dataset mit Ein- und Ausstiegsorten von Taxis herunter und ermitteln mit GeoAnalytics Tools, an welchen Orten die meisten Ausstiege vorliegen.
Voraussetzung
Stellen Sie sicher, dass Ihr ArcGIS Enterprise-Administrator GeoAnalytics Server konfiguriert hat. Weitere Informationen finden Sie unter Einrichten von ArcGIS GeoAnalytics Server.
Die Daten vorbereiten
Führen Sie die folgenden Schritte aus, um die in diesem Beispiel verwendeten Daten herunterzuladen und vorzubereiten:
- Erstellen Sie einen Ordner namens BigDataExample an einem Speicherort, der für Ihren GeoAnalytics Server verfügbar ist. Erstellen Sie im Ordner BigDataExample einen Ordner namens NYCTaxi.
- Rufen Sie https://www1.nyc.gov/site/tlc/about/tlc-trip-record-data.page auf, und laden Sie die Yellow Taxi-Daten von Januar und Februar 2014 in den Ordner BigDataExample > NYCTaxi herunter.
Erstellen einer Big-Data-Dateifreigabe
Nachdem Sie die Daten an einem Speicherort gespeichert haben, auf den alle GeoAnalytics Server-Computer zugreifen können, registrieren Sie sie über das Portal bei Ihrem GeoAnalytics Server als Big-Data-Dateifreigabe. Mit einer Big-Data-Dateifreigabe wird ein Big-Data-Katalog-Service erstellt, der in GeoAnalytics Server-Werkzeugen verwendet werden kann. Um die Big-Data-Dateifreigabe zu erstellen, führen Sie die folgenden Schritte aus:
- Melden Sie sich bei Ihrem ArcGIS Enterprise-Portal an.
Die URL liegt im Format https://webadaptorhost.domain.com/arcgis/home vor, wobei arcgis der Name des beim Portal registrierten Web Adaptor ist.
- Navigieren Sie zu Inhalt > Neues Element, und wählen Sie Data Store aus.
- Geben Sie im Feld Titel einen Namen für die Big-Data-Dateifreigabe ein.
- Wählen Sie die Option Big-Data-Dateifreigabe aus. Klicken Sie auf Weiter, um mit Schritt 2: Verbindung konfigurieren fortzufahren.
- Wählen Sie die erste Option für Dateifreigabe aus, und klicken Sie auf Weiter.
- Geben Sie im Feld Pfad den Dateipfad zu Ihrem BigDataExample-Ordner ein.
Beispiel: Geben Sie für einen Ordner mit dem Namen BigDataExample unter Microsoft Windows in einem Verzeichnis mit dem Namen sharedLocation Folgendes ein: \\sharedLocation\BigDataExample. Geben Sie für denselben Ordnerpfad unter LinuxFolgendes ein: /sharedLocation/BigDataExample.
- Klicken Sie auf Weiter, um mit Schritt 3: Server konfigurieren fortzufahren.
- Warten Sie, bis der GeoAnalytics Server die Überprüfung abgeschlossen hat.
- Sobald in der Spalte Status ein grünes Häkchen erscheint, klicken Sie auf Data Store hinzufügen.
Daraufhin werden zwei Elemente erstellt: eines für die Big-Data-Dateifreigabe und eines für den Data Store. Das Big-Data-Dateifreigabeelement macht die Datasets verfügbar, sodass Sie Eigenschaften wie Schema, Geometrie und Zeit prüfen und aktualisieren können. Das Big-Data-Dateifreigabeelement entspricht einem zugrunde liegenden Big-Data-Katalog-Service, der über eine URL im folgenden Format verfügbar ist:
https://gisserver.domain.com:6443/arcgis/rest/services/DataStoreCatalogs/bigDataFileShares_FileShareName/BigDataCatalogServer
In der Beispiel-URL oben ist FileShareName der Titel, den Sie für den Data Store angegeben haben, als Sie ihn beim GeoAnalytics Server registriert haben.
Bearbeiten einer Big-Data-Dateifreigabe
In diesem Lernprogramm enthält die Big-Data-Dateifreigabe ein Dataset, NYCTaxi, das nach dem Ordner Ihrer Big-Data-Dateifreigabe benannt ist.
Dieses Dataset enthält mehrere Datums- und Uhrzeitfelder. Untersuchen Sie das Dataset, um sicherzustellen, dass Sie die richtigen Felder verwenden. Um die Datasets in der Big-Data-Dateifreigabe anzuzeigen und zu bearbeiten, navigieren Sie zum Portal-Inhaltselement Big-Data-Dateifreigabe, wechseln Sie zur Seite Datasets, und klicken Sie neben dem Dataset auf die Schaltfläche "Bearbeiten". Bei der Erstellung der Big-Data-Dateifreigabe werden die Parameter geometry und time so festgelegt, dass darin die Informationen zu Einstiegsorten verwendet werden. Für dieses Lernprogramm möchten Sie Analysen für die Ausstiegsorte ausführen.
Hinweis:
Beim Erstellen der Big-Data-Dateifreigabe werden Geometrie und Zeit anhand einer bestmöglichen Schätzung dargestellt.
In diesem Lernprogramm ändern Sie die Dataset-Eigenschaften so, dass die Ausstiegszeiten und -orte verwendet werden. Dies bedeutet, dass die Analyse die Ausstiegsorte anstelle der Einstiegsorte aggregiert. Beide Geometriegruppen (Einstieg oder Ausstieg) können für die Analyse herangezogen werden. Welche jeweils geeignet ist, hängt davon ab, welches Problem Sie lösen möchten. Diese Änderungen werden im Dialogfeld Dataset-Eigenschaften bearbeiten des Big-Data-Dateifreigabe-Datasets vorgenommen.
Hinweis:
Alternativ können Sie das Manifest herunterladen, bearbeiten und anschließend das geänderte Manifest wieder hochladen. Weitere Informationen zum Bearbeiten des Manifests selbst finden Sie unter Manifest zur Big-Data-Dateifreigabe.
- Navigieren Sie auf der Seite des Big-Data-Dateifreigabeelements zur Registerkarte Datasets.
- Klicken Sie auf die Schaltfläche "Bearbeiten" neben dem Dataset NYCTaxi, um dessen Eigenschaften zu bearbeiten.
Das Dialogfeld Dataset-Eigenschaften bearbeiten wird angezeigt.
- Die Registerkarte Geometrie zeigt, dass zum Darstellen der X- und Y-Werte aktuell die Felder pickup_longitude und pickup_latitude verwendet werden. Ändern Sie die Werte wie folgt:
- Ändern Sie den Wert für X-Feld von pickup_longitude in dropoff_longitude.
- Ändern Sie den Wert für Y-Feld von pickup_latitude in dropoff_latitude.
- Die Registerkarte Zeit zeigt, dass zum Darstellen der Zeitwerte aktuell das Feld pickup_datetime mit dem Format JJJJ-MM-TT hh:mm:ss verwendet wird. Ändern Sie die Einstellung für Zeitfeld von pickup_datetime in dropoff_datetime.
- Klicken Sie auf Speichern, um die Änderungen an Ihrem Big-Data-Dateifreigabe-Dataset zu speichern.
Durchführen einer Analyse der Taxidaten im ArcGIS Enterprise-Portal
Nachdem Sie die Daten und das Big-Data-Dateifreigabeelement erstellt haben, können Sie zum Big-Data-Dateifreigabeelement in Ihrer Portal-Organisation navigieren, um auf Ihre Datasets zuzugreifen. Sie können diese Datasets zur Ausführung von GeoAnalytics Server-Werkzeugen verwenden.
Hinweis:
Beim GeoAnalytics Server registrierte Daten werden nicht auf den Server hochgeladen, sondern lediglich beim GeoAnalytics Server registriert. Das Schema wird in einem Manifest definiert.
- Klicken Sie im Portal auf Karte, um zu Map Viewer Classic zu wechseln.
- Klicken Sie auf die Schaltfläche Analyse.
Wenn sowohl Feature- als auch Raster-Analysen verfügbar sind, klicken Sie auf Feature-Analyse und dann auf GeoAnalytics Tools > Daten zusammenfassen > Punkte aggregieren.
- Geben Sie New York in die Suchleiste Adresse oder Ort suchen ein, und klicken Sie auf Suchen.
Ihre Karte wird auf die Ausdehnung von New York City gezoomt.
- Wählen Sie für den ersten Parameter des Werkzeugs Analyse-Layer auswählen, um das Dataset der Taxis in New York City als Layer für die Aggregation hinzuzufügen. Wählen Sie in dem Dialogfeld, das daraufhin angezeigt wird, Inhalt aus, und navigieren zu Ihrer Big-Data-Dateifreigabe. Wählen Sie den Layer mit den Taxis in New York City aus, und klicken Sie auf Auswählen.
- Fassen Sie die Daten zu quadratischen Abschnitten mit einer Seitenlänge von 1 Kilometer zusammen.
- Da es sich um Daten mit aktivierten Zeiteigenschaften handelt, können Sie Zeitschritte anwenden. Sie wissen, dass Sie die Daten von zwei Monaten heruntergeladen haben. In diesem Lernprogramm untersuchen Sie von jedem Monat die Daten der ersten Woche. Hierfür legen Sie als Zeitschrittintervall den Wert 1 Woche fest, für Wie häufig der Zeitschritt wiederholt werden soll stellen Sie 1 Monat ein, und Zeit zum Ausrichten von Zeitschritten legen Sie auf den 1. Januar 2017 12:00 Uhr fest. Die Testdaten beziehen sich zwar auf das Jahr 2014, mit dem Werkzeug Punkte aggregieren haben Sie jedoch die Möglichkeit einer zeitlichen Ausrichtung in die Zukunft und Vergangenheit.
- Wählen Sie die gewünschten Statistiken aus. Einige Beispiele sind der Mittelwert von total_amount oder der Varianzwert der Streckenlänge.
- Legen Sie als Raumbezug eine lokale Projektion von New York fest. Gehen Sie dazu folgendermaßen vor:
- Klicken Sie auf die Schaltfläche "Einstellungen", um auf die Analyseeinstellungen zuzugreifen.
- Wählen Sie Wie angegeben in der Dropdown-Liste Verarbeitungskoordinatensystem aus.
- Klicken Sie auf den Globus, und suchen Sie nach der UTM-Zone 18N, indem Sie auf Raumbezüge > PCS > UTM > WGS 1984 UTM Zone 18 N klicken.
- Klicken Sie auf OK und dann auf Übernehmen.
- Zoomen Sie auf den Großraum New York City, stellen Sie sicher, dass die Option Aktuelle Kartenausdehnung verwenden im Werkzeug Punkte aggregieren aktiviert ist, und führen Sie die Analyse aus.
Die Analyse wird auf den Computern im GeoAnalytics Server ausgeführt. Wenn die Analyse abgeschlossen ist, werden die Ergebnisse Ihrer Karte hinzugefügt. Die Ergebnisse werden als quadratische Polygone dargestellt, die die Anzahl der Ausstiegsorte in jedem Polygon sowie die zusätzlich von Ihnen berechneten Statistiken angeben. Ihre Ergebnisse umfassen etwa 3.500 bis 4.000 Features. Die Ergebnisse hängen von der Ausdehnung der Karte auf Ihrem Bildschirm und Ihrer Zeitzone ab.